How do I open folder as administrator?

To open an administrative Command Prompt window in the current folder, use this hidden Windows 10 feature: Navigate to the folder you want to use, then tap Alt, F, M, A (that keyboard shortcut is the same as switching to the File tab on the ribbon, then choosing Open command prompt as administrator).

How do I change folder permissions?

You can access these permissions by right-clicking on a file or folder, choosing Properties and then clicking on the Security tab. To edit permissions for a particular user, click on that user and then click the Edit button.

How do I change folder permissions in Windows?

To set permissions for an object:

  1. In Windows Explorer, right-click a file, folder or volume and choose Properties from the context menu. The Properties dialog box appears.
  2. Click the Security tab.
  3. Under Group or user names, select or add a group or user.
  4. At the bottom, allow or deny one of the available permissions.

How do I run Windows 10 as an administrator?

If you’d like to run a Windows 10 app as an administrator, open the Start menu and locate the app on the list. Right-click the app’s icon, then select “More” from the menu that appears. In the “More” menu, select “Run as administrator.”

How do I force ownership of a folder?

How to Take Ownership of a Folder in Windows 10 Using File Explorer

  1. Right-click on a file or folder.
  2. Select Properties.
  3. Click the Security tab.
  4. Click Advanced.
  5. Click “Change” next to the owner name.
  6. Click Advanced.
  7. Click Find Now.
  8. Select your username and click OK.

How do I remove folder permissions in Windows 10?

If you want to change the permission of each folder, you can do the following:

  1. Launch Windows Explorer.
  2. Right-click on a folder, then choose Properties.
  3. Go to Security tab.
  4. Click Edit under Groups or user names section.
  5. Highlight the user you want to remove, and click Remove.

How do I get Administrator permission to save a file?

Step 1: Right-click the folder you want to save files to and select Properties from the context menu. Step 2: Select Security tab in the pop-up window, and click Edit to change permission. Step 3: Select Administrators and check Full control in Allow column. Then click OK to save the changes.
